Table 4. Percent of employees offered other employee benefits, various employment groups, 1994-96



Table 4.  Percent of employees offered other employee benefits, various employment
groups, 1994-96
                                                                                        
                                                                                        
                                                        Full-time employees in -        
                                                                                        
                                   Part-time                                            
    Employee benefit program       employees                   Medium and   Small inde- 
                                      1996      Small estab-  large estab-    pendent   
                                                 lishments     lishments   establishmen-
                                                    1994        1995(1)          ts     
                                                                              1996(2)   
                                                                                                                                                                                
                                                                                        
   Income contribution plans                                                            
 Severance pay..................        2            15            35            12     
 Supplemental unemployment                                                              
    benefits....................      (3)           (3)             4           (3)     
                                                                                        
        Family benefits                                                                 
 Child care.....................        2             1             8             1     
  Funds.........................        1             1             4             1     
  On-site care..................        1             1             3             1     
  Off-site care.................        1           (3)             1             1     
 Adoption assistance............      (3)           n.a.           11             1     
 Long-term care insurance.......      (3)             1             6             1     
 Flexible workplace.............        1           n.a.            2             1     
                                                                                        
   Health promotion programs                                                            
 Wellness.......................        6             6            34             5     
 Employee assistance............        9            15            58             9     
 Fitness center.................        3           n.a.           19             4     
                                                                                        
     Miscellaneous benefits                                                             
 Job-related travel accident                                                            
    insurance...................        4            13            41             7     
 Nonproduction bonuses..........       26            47            39            48     
 Subsidized commuting...........      (3)             1             5             1     
                                                                                        
    Educational assistance:                                                             
 Job-related....................       13            37            65            34     
 Non-job-related................        2             6            18             3     
                                                                                        
Section 125 cafeteria                                                                   
   benefits(4)..................        4            22            55            16     
   Flexible benefit plans.......        1             3            12             2     
   Reimbursement plans..........        3            19            38             8     
   Premium conversion plans.....        1           n.a.            5             5     

  1 Private establishments employing 100 or more workers.
  2 Not under common ownership or control with any other establishment.
  3 Less than 0.5 percent.
  4 Includes all types of plans under Internal Revenue Code, Section 125.  Flexible
benefit plans include reimbursement account features.
n.a. Data were not available for this benefit in 1994.

  NOTE: Dash indicates no data were reported; sums of individual items may not equal
totals due to rounding.
